Originally Posted by Rich Mickol
Anyone know why they don't cover them after they park them out there.
Why? ......because leaving a car cover on a parked car in the intense heated sunlight will cause more paint damage than protect it. Also, if these shipping covers are not 100% watertight, then you'll have rain water & moisture trapped under them and then they get baked in the intense heat & sunlight. Bad way to ruin a new paint job.

Better to allow the paint to fully cure in the natural environment.

I say leave 'em all with no covers until the day of shipment. These guys have done this before......this is NOT the first car they've stored.

My current 2012 C6 sat in the intense heat of Miami sunlight for almost 8 months before I bought it. The paint is flawless.
